Photos: A Forest Hills snow/slush day

February 21, 2019 by FHC

by Marlene Berlin

Residents of Forest Hills DC woke up to snow on Wednesday. We are used to waking up to the sound of early morning snowplows on these days, but as of 2:30 p.m. many of the streets and sidewalks remained unplowed and unshoveled.

The first plow came up 30th Street at 4:10 p.m. Terry Owens of DDOT reported there were 200 trucks out working 12-hour shifts.

A warming trend that was set to begin overnight and a forecast high of 56 today should take care of any remaining slushy streets and unshoveled sidewalks.
